Yes your problem is that aftermarket exhaust. Someone must have figured if the brace don't fit break it... and install half of it. Can't tell from the photos but could you remove the exhaust, install the brace then reinstall the exhaust with some ajustements? The joints around the muffler can be twisted to reposition it to some degree. Otherwise I would fabricate a brace the fits around the exhaust. Use the brace you bought as a jig to properly place the attachement points.
